3. “Integrated Molding” vs. The “Sticker” Industry
This is the most critical distinction for a buyer. A “cheap” carbon board is often just a plastic shell with a Water Transfer Print (Hydro-dip) or a thin sticker. These provide zero structural benefit and actually add dead weight.
